Romolo Buccellato
Romolo Buccellato operates in Terre Siciliane, the expansive wine region of southern Sicily. The winery produces wines from indigenous Sicilian varieties, anchored by Il Cigno Nero Cerasuolo di Vittoria, a structured red blend that has drawn attention from Wine Enthusiast and Wine Spectator. The portfolio includes Frappato, a native varietal known for its bright acidity and mineral character, and Grillo, the aromatic white that defines much of Sicily's modern wine identity. These wines reflect the volcanic soils and Mediterranean climate of the region, where traditional Sicilian grapes continue to find expression in contemporary winemaking.
